The Evolution of Sports Betting in California
The roots of sports betting in California can be traced back to the early 20th century, though it remained largely underground for decades. The rise of modern sports betting began in the 1970s, when various forms of gambling were legalized across the United States. Over the years, California has witnessed several pivotal moments in its journey toward a regulated sports betting market.
- The introduction of the Indian Gaming Regulatory Act in 1988 allowed Native American tribes to operate casinos, paving the way for sports betting.
- The Supreme Court’s decision in 2018 to overturn PASPA opened the floodgates for states to legalize sports betting, and California began considering its options.
- In recent years, legislation has been proposed to legalize sports betting both online and at physical locations, highlighting California’s desire to tap into this lucrative market.

Effective Betting Strategies
To increase your chances of success in sports betting, consider implementing these strategies:
- Bankroll Management: Set aside a specific amount for betting and never exceed it. This helps manage risk and avoid significant losses.
- Do Your Homework: Research teams, players, statistics, and other factors that influence outcomes. Knowledge is power.
- Shop for Odds: Different sportsbooks may offer varying odds on the same event. Compare odds to find the best value.
- Stay Disciplined: Avoid emotional betting based on fandom. Stick to your strategies and principles.
- Keep Records: Document your bets, wins, and losses to analyze your performance and adapt your strategies.
Responsible Gaming Practices
While sports betting can be fun and entertaining, it’s crucial to engage in responsible gaming. Here are some practices to consider:
- Set Limits: Establish betting limits on time and money to prevent excessive gambling.
- Self-Exclusion: If you feel your betting habits are becoming problematic, utilize self-exclusion programs offered by sportsbooks.
- Seek Support: Reach out to organizations that offer support for gambling addiction if you or someone you know is struggling.
- Stay Informed: Educate yourself about the risks associated with gambling and practice moderation.
